Summer 2025. Nike announces the Air Max 1000 in collaboration with Zellerfeld: the brand’s first fully 3D-printed trainer to hit the shelves, rather than a conceptual display case. In the same year, Adidas finalises plans for the mass production of fully additive footwear, whilst Zellerfeld concludes its beta phase and opens its platform to third-party designers.

The global market for 3D-printed footwear is worth around $2.5 billion in 2025, with projections exceeding $5 billion by 2030 and an estimated CAGR of 18–19% (Expert Market Research, Technavio). These figures are changing the conversation: it is no longer a question of ‘if’ additive manufacturing will enter footwear production, but ‘how’ the supply chain is preparing.

The revolution isn’t confined to the sole — where a ‘bow tie’ lattice developed by Carbon in collaboration with Adidas converts vertical pressure into horizontal thrust — but extends to the upper, accessories and embellishments. For years, we’ve read about 3D printing in fashion, but it seemed more like trade fair rhetoric. Then came the industrial applications.
Stratasys, the PolyJet technology multinational, has developed the J85 TechStyle: a printer that deposits polymer via inkjet directly onto fabric. Denim, cotton, polyester, linen, leather. Print areas of up to two metres, over 600,000 colours, accessories — buttons, cufflinks, bag buckles — printable up to 50 mm in height. The software interfaces with factory MES systems. The Italian side has a name: Dyloan, with the Milan-based D-house, which also houses an academy for fashion designers.
Critical points: to democratise on-demand production — “zero stock” is Zellerfeld’s slogan — a technological and training infrastructure is required that is anything but lightweight. Customising millions of items costs more than mass-producing millions. At least for now.
